Minnesota House Bill HF5479

Introduced
5/18/24  

Caption

Conduct of advance deposit wagering, card playing, and pari-mutuel betting provided; authorization of historical horse racing and other games prohibited; definitions provided; and clarifying and conforming changes made.

Summary

HF5479 is a legislative bill that addresses the regulation of horse racing in Minnesota, specifically focusing on the conduct of advance deposit wagering (ADW), card playing, and pari-mutuel betting. The bill seeks to prohibit the authorization of historical horse racing and several other gaming methods while providing definitions for different types of wagering. The amendments made to existing statutes aim to clarify and conform various aspects of the law related to these activities, signaling the state's intent to maintain strict regulations on gambling practices associated with horse racing.
